The Billbug cyberespionage group (also known as Thrip, Lotus Blossom, Spring Dragon) has targeted a certificate authority, government agencies, and defense organizations in several Asian countries in recent months through an ongoing campaign.

The group has been carrying out these attacks for years, with the most recent being seen since March. It is believed to be a state-sponsored group from China.
Its activities have been documented by multiple cybersecurity companies over the past six years.

In a report today, Symantec security researchers say that the Billbug group, which they have been monitoring since 2018, has also targeted a certificate authority company . If successful, this would allow for easier deployment of signed malware and make it harder to detect or decrypt HTTPS traffic .
New campaign, old tools
Symantec has not determined how Billbug initially gains access to target networks, but has seen evidence that it does so by exploiting public-facing applications with known vulnerabilities .
As in other campaigns attributed to the Billbug group, the threat actor combines tools already installed on the target system, utilities , and malware created specifically for this purpose. These include:
- AdFind
- Winmail
- WinRAR
- Ping
- Tracert
- Route
- NBTscan
- Certutil
- Port Scanner
These tools make it easier for hackers to go unnoticed while blending in with everyday activity. With these tools, hackers can avoid raising an alarm in security tools , thus making it more difficult to perform the hack.
A more rarely developed open source tool seen in recent Billbug features is Stowaway, a Go-based multi-layer proxy tool that helps users bypass network access restrictions .
Symantec was able to link the recent attacks to Billbug because it used two backdoors that had been observed in its previous attacks: Hannotog and Sagerunex.
Some of the Hannotog backdoor's functions include changing firewall settings to enable all traffic, persistence on the compromised machine, uploading encrypted data, executing CMD commands, and downloading files to the device.

Sagerunex is dropped by Hannotog and injected into an “explorer.exe” process. It then writes logs to a local temp file encrypted using the AES (256-bit) algorithm.

The backdoor's configuration and state are stored locally and encrypted with RC4. However, the keys for both of these features are hardcoded into the malware.

Sagerunex uses HTTPS to communicate with the command and command server, sending a list of active proxies and files, as well as receiving payload and shell commands from operators. In addition, it can execute programs and DLLs using “runexe” or “rundll”.
The Billbug team uses the same custom backdoors with minimal changes over the years.
